2016 AZN to MAD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016

During 2016, the AZN to MAD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on May 28, valuing the pair at 6.5739.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 31, dropping to 5.6162.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.9576 MAD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 6.2543 to the December average rate of 5.7072, the exchange rate registered a net change of -8.75%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 6.5739 was down 46.67% compared to the 2015 peak of 12.3269,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

AZN to MAD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 6.2807, compared to 5.9637 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the first half (Jan–Jun) by a margin of 0.3171 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2016 was March, with a trading range of 0.4779 MAD (High: 6.3502 / Low: 5.8723). On the other end, September was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.1239 MAD (High: 5.9731 / Low: 5.8493).
